| Index: chrome/browser/signin/signin_manager_factory.cc
|
| diff --git a/chrome/browser/signin/signin_manager_factory.cc b/chrome/browser/signin/signin_manager_factory.cc
|
| index 96856204292365b089c3f6396f3f8fc57089a039..10f458d7a3c6c1735c1bb8df5bf2a1324015e233 100644
|
| --- a/chrome/browser/signin/signin_manager_factory.cc
|
| +++ b/chrome/browser/signin/signin_manager_factory.cc
|
| @@ -100,7 +100,8 @@ void SigninManagerFactory::RemoveObserver(Observer* observer) {
|
|
|
| void SigninManagerFactory::NotifyObserversOfSigninManagerCreationForTesting(
|
| SigninManagerBase* manager) {
|
| - FOR_EACH_OBSERVER(Observer, observer_list_, SigninManagerCreated(manager));
|
| + for (Observer& observer : observer_list_)
|
| + observer.SigninManagerCreated(manager);
|
| }
|
|
|
| KeyedService* SigninManagerFactory::BuildServiceInstanceFor(
|
| @@ -122,7 +123,8 @@ KeyedService* SigninManagerFactory::BuildServiceInstanceFor(
|
| AccountFetcherServiceFactory::GetForProfile(profile);
|
| #endif
|
| service->Initialize(g_browser_process->local_state());
|
| - FOR_EACH_OBSERVER(Observer, observer_list_, SigninManagerCreated(service));
|
| + for (Observer& observer : observer_list_)
|
| + observer.SigninManagerCreated(service);
|
| return service;
|
| }
|
|
|
| @@ -130,7 +132,9 @@ void SigninManagerFactory::BrowserContextShutdown(
|
| content::BrowserContext* context) {
|
| SigninManagerBase* manager = static_cast<SigninManagerBase*>(
|
| GetServiceForBrowserContext(context, false));
|
| - if (manager)
|
| - FOR_EACH_OBSERVER(Observer, observer_list_, SigninManagerShutdown(manager));
|
| + if (manager) {
|
| + for (Observer& observer : observer_list_)
|
| + observer.SigninManagerShutdown(manager);
|
| + }
|
| BrowserContextKeyedServiceFactory::BrowserContextShutdown(context);
|
| }
|
|
|